China says Dec foreign direct investment down 5.8% y-o-y
Published Wed, Jan 20, 2016 · 02:25 AM
[BEIJING] China attracted US$12.23 billion in foreign direct investment (FDI) in December, down 5.8 per cent from a year earlier, the Commerce Ministry said on Wednesday.
China's non-financial outbound direct investment (ODI) in December rose 6.1 percent from a year earlier to US$13.89 billion, the ministry said.
